Action item from the Glimmerfall outage review: the on-call alert deduplicator in Signalbay collapsed distinct auth-failure alerts into one, so we missed the second wave for 40 minutes. We're tightening the dedupe key to include source service and principal, and adding a bypass for security-class alerts. Heads up for the security review: dedupe rules are config-driven and hot-reloadable, which needs scrutiny. Current rule set and change history are documented on the page below.

wiki page, tahaf-tajog: https://jira.ordindyn.corp/pipeline

Ticket: Staging env misconfigured for Siftgate bloom filter

The bloom layer in front of the Pellet KV store is rejecting all lookups in staging because the env file was copied from the dev template without credentials. False-positive tuning values are fine; only the auth line is missing. To unblock the weekly demo, the Pellet admission secret must be set on the following line.

env line for yaguf-fajop: LEDGER_TOKEN13=fb08984397349

Subject: Quickstore 4.2 — bloom filter now fronts the KV layer

Plugin authors: starting with this release, Quickstore places a bloom filter ahead of the key-value store. Negative lookups return faster; false positives fall through safely. No API changes are required on your side. Verify your plugin against the staging build referenced below.

session token of fahif-tadup = htk3_9c7